What affects the price

Cruise pricing shifts based on a few key variables. Your c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a room with a balcony naturally costs more than an interior cabin. Where you choose to sail and how far out you book also play a significant role. Last-minute deals can sometimes save you money, but booking early often secures better perks or specific room locations. Viking focuses on cultural immersion through river travel, mainly in Europe. These cruises move through the heart of cities, offering smaller ships that dock right in town centers. What are the unique offerings of Virgin Voyages cruises?

Virgin Voyages distinguishes itself by offering an adults-only (18+) cruise experience with a modern, stylish aesthetic and a focus on entertainment and dining. They aim to attract a younger demographic and those seeking a contemporary feel, often including unique onboard features like a tattoo parlor and a running track. Their 'all-inclusive' approach typically covers gratuities, Wi-Fi, and basic beverages, simplifying the onboard budget.

What are the best family-friendly cruise options available?

Family-friendly cruises typically feature extensive kids' clubs with supervised activities, dedicated family entertainment like shows and character meet-and-greets, and diverse dining options to suit all palates. Cruise lines like Disney, Royal Caribbean, and Carnival are renowned for their family-focused amenities, including water slides, sports courts, and family suites. When is the optimal time to book cruises for 2026?

Booking cruises for 2026 is best done as soon as itineraries are released, typically 12-18 months in advance. This provides the widest selection of sailings, cabin categories, and the best opportunity to secure early booking discounts. Waiting too long can result in limited availability, particularly for popular destinations and specific ship classes. Planning ahead ensures you can tailor the cruise to your exact requirements.
